Wire antenna with gain?

 VK3YE has a new video about some experiments with his EFZZ antenna. It appears to have some gain in certain directions.  It is very hard to know the directivity and gain as this will depend on bands, local obstructions, band conditions etc. It might make a useful portable antenna.
